How to Find the Best Supplier for your Needs

Suppliers are everywhere.

If you are just starting a business, you have the choice of trying to buy all of your supplies directly from the manufacturer, buying them online, or even finding a local supplier.

While there never is a one size fits all solution to anything in business, some suppliers are going to be better than others, and their different approaches can pay off if you find the right one for your needs.

When looking at a supplier, there are some questions that you should ask yourself:

Should You Be More Eco-Friendly With Your Choices?

You may think that being eco-friendly and sustainable shouldn’t be a consideration for your business, but is always buying single-use a good use of your money?

Buying something that is meant to be reused could save you money, but it also can cut down on waste that could be recycled.

By trying to reduce the amount of waste you are generating, you can save money and reduce the number of materials that are going into landfills and polluting the environment.

Do You Need to Save Money or Time?

There is nothing worse than waiting for supplies to arrive as they are shipped and sent overseas, so it is important to consider your time as a business owner and how often that can mean making purchases.

Asking yourself if the price is right and if it will take too much time to get your supplies can often help you make the best choice for your business.

Do You Need to Source Local Supplies?

Sometimes it is worth getting a supply from somewhere that is close to where you are located in order to reduce shipping costs and reduce the impact on the environment.

By finding a local supplier, you can get what you need without having to pay for international shipping as well, which also reduces costs.

Buying local is always going to be the most environmentally friendly option, but it can also ensure that your customers feel more connected to your business if they live nearby. Having a local supplier will also help you save money due to shipping costs and other delays that can impact when something arrives.
